Abstract
A system for preventing drowsiness in a driver by employing a thermal grill. The system includes a detection module and an intervention module. The detection module monitors a driver'"'"'s parameters to determine whether the driver is drowsy. If the driver is determined to be drowsy, the intervention module activates a thermal grill with interlaced hot and cold regions. This activation causes the hot regions to approach one temperature and the cold regions to approach another. Additionally, this activation leads to an uncomfortable sensation for the driver, alerts the driver, and prevents the driver from getting drowsy.
